Simple; Set a maintenance word on the database(s)
DButil will allow database maintenance from a non-creator user/account
if the maintenance word is known.

> I am looking for a way to permit ordinary users (programmers and support
> staff) to see who is using a TurboIMAGE database, and what locks are in
> effect and are pending--the information you would see with DBUTIL using
> SHOW ... USERS and SHOW ... LOCKS or SHOW ... ALL.
>
> I have to work within these constraints: (1) Can't let them log on with
> SM capability. (2) Can't let them log on as the database creator. (3)
> Can't reveal the password on the MPEX GOD program. (4) Can't reveal the
> password on DBUTIL.
>
> Any suggestions? Any utility to do this?
>
> My best idea so far is to set up a command file that would use the MPEX
> %WITHCAPS command to grant SM capability temporarily, then run DBUTIL.
